Trailer Tire Recommendation to Replace Size 185/65-14
Question:
I have a boat trailer with two 185/65 R14s! They are car radial tires, and want to go to correct trailer tires. I have plenty of room in the fender, so could easily go up in tire size. What do you recommend?
asked by: Stuart E
0
Expert Reply:
The closest tire size to what you have now of 185/65-14 would be the tire size 205/75-14 like with the part # TR20514 which has an outer diameter of 26.14 inch and a section width of 8 inches.
What you have now is most likely a passenger vehicle tire size which was not designed or rated for use on a trailer.
